Transaction 34de2bba52776abe181e19ac28c09da9ef2b7fa37396dcc729879711cbd974cc

1 Input
2 Outputs
  • 34de2bba52776abe181e19ac28c09da9ef2b7fa37396dcc729879711cbd974cc:0
  • value  25000000
    address  16a17QT6WfsXE19PHLUFinE6pVKtGLguoK
  • 34de2bba52776abe181e19ac28c09da9ef2b7fa37396dcc729879711cbd974cc:1
  • value  224995437
    address  39T5Dc1pS1jpK9vKYZRZbBfgdZvHckn1tW